askropp wrote:My notes say he was captured / arrested on 04.06.1945 in Bad Wiessee.
Confirmed by his biography (Kirstin A. Schäfer: Werner von Blomberg: Hitlers erster Feldmarschall. Eine Biographie)

Apparenly US officials paid him their first visit on 30.05.1945 in his house in Bad Wiessee. He was placed under arrest on 04.06.1945 and spent the following years in prisons in Nürnberg and Oberursel im Taunus. On 16.02.1946 he was transferred to the hospital, where on 20.02.1946 he was diagnosed with colorectal cancer (cancer of the large intestine).
